100% Pure Essential Oil

Botanical Name: Mentha pipertia
Origin: India
Aroma: Cooling and invigorating with strong mint freshness.
Extraction mMethod: Steam Distillation
Plant Part: Lamiaceae
Notes: High
Extraction Section: Herb

- Refreshes and energizes
- Relieves headaches and nasal congestion
- Antibacterial effects

Emotional Benefits: Energizes, sharpens focus, and revitalizes the spirit.

Physical Benefits: Relieves headaches and muscle spasms, supports digestion, improves respiratory health, and alleviates nausea or dizziness.

Skin Benefits: Cooling and soothing, cleanses oily skin, and calms allergies or inflammation.

薄荷 (拉丁學名 - Mentha piperita) 隸屬於唇形科 (Lamiaceae)。產於美國與塔斯馬尼亞。

薄荷曾經在埃及草藥典中被提及,用於緩解胃部的不適,從中東地區,薄荷傳入希臘,並進入希臘神話之中。而⌈薄荷⌋這個名字也從希臘神話中產生。到了現代,薄荷被證實在助消化、驅除脹氣、緩解痙攣和結腸炎有療效。

How to use

Diffuser

  • Add 8-10 drops of essential oil per 100ml of water.
  • Creates a calming and soothing atmosphere, ideal for relaxation and air purification.

Massage

  • Mix 8-10 drops of essential oil with 20ml of carrier oil.
  • Gently massage the body to promote relaxation and relieve stress.

Relaxing Bath

  • Blend 4-6 drops of essential oil with bath salts.
  • Enjoy a soothing soak to unwind and relax after a long day.

Meditation Aid

  • Apply diluted essential oil to wrists or diffuse during meditation.
  • Creates a serene and focused environment to enhance mindfulness.

Essential oils contain highly concentrated aromatic molecules found in small quantities in plants, such as flowers, leaves, peels, or roots. Extracting these potent compounds requires large amounts of plant material, which contributes to the high purity and efficacy of essential oils.

No, the concentration of aromatic molecules varies across plants, so the amount of raw material needed differs. For example, rose essential oil requires thousands of kilograms of petals, while lavender oil may only need a few hundred kilograms of plant material.

The cost of essential oils depends on factors like the rarity of the raw material, sourcing location, extraction difficulty, and purity. For instance, rose essential oil is pricier due to the large volume of petals and complex extraction process. High-purity, organic-certified oils also command higher prices due to their superior quality.

High-quality essential oils come from plants grown in optimal conditions, harvested at the right time, and processed with professional extraction techniques. Avoid Direct Skin Contact: Essential oils are highly concentrated and should be diluted before use, especially for sensitive skin.

Keep Away from Eyes and Mucous Membranes: Avoid applying oils to sensitive areas to prevent irritation.

Special Populations: Pregnant women, breastfeeding mothers, and infants should consult a doctor before use, as some oils may not be suitable.

Individual Reactions: Certain oils, like peppermint, should not be used by individuals with G6PD deficiency, as reactions vary. Always perform a patch test and consult a professional if unsure.
